The distribution of the surname 'Barraso' is interesting, with a notable concentration in Spain, followed by the United States and other countries. Below is an analysis of the surname's incidence across different countries:
With 322 occurrences, Spain is the country where the surname 'Barraso' is predominantly found. Spanish surnames typically reflect regional ancestry, suggesting that the bearers of the name in Spain may belong to specific provinces or municipalities. The prevalence in Spain may also indicate familial lineages that trace back to the Iberian Peninsula.
In the United States, the surname 'Barraso' appears 29 times. This lower incidence can be attributed to immigration patterns, where individuals bearing the surname likely migrated from Spanish-speaking countries, especially Spain and Latin America. The assimilation process often led to changes in the surname, which may account for the reduced number in the U.S.
Barraso is also present in Brazil (9 occurrences) and Venezuela (4 occurrences), showcasing the influence of Spanish migration during the colonial and post-colonial periods. These countries have strong historical ties to Spain, contributing to the distribution of surnames like 'Barraso'. In Brazil, the Portuguese influence may have resulted in adaptations or variations of the name.
The surname appears to have a declining incidence in countries like Italy (2 occurrences), Argentina (1 occurrence), Honduras (1 occurrence), and Japan (1 occurrence). The low numbers in these countries suggest that 'Barraso' may have historical significance for specific families or migrated groups rather than being a widespread surname.
